Third-party plugins for the PedalFlow rebalancing engine must authenticate before submitting dock-priority hints or reading station occupancy forecasts. All requests go through the internal RouteMint broker, which validates your credential, enforces per-plugin rate limits, and rejects hints that reference unknown station identifiers. Credentials are scoped: a hint-writer key cannot read forecasts, and vice versa. For local development against the staging broker, initialize your client with the shared sandbox credential shown below.

service key, fawip-bajef: kto11_Qt5wZK9vdNC

Annual Billing Transition — Managers Only

Scope: all Pinefort Suite accounts move to annual billing next fiscal year. Monthly option retained for legacy Tallrock contracts only. Branch managers: brief your account leads after the all-hands, not before. Discount authority capped at 8% without regional sign-off. FAQ draft lands Friday. Escalations go through the pricing desk. The confidential plan summary sits below this line.

board note of bawep-tajef: Queniusek Systems plans to raise the Quenvan list price by 53.1 percent in March. The pricing group signed off on a budget of $176.4 million for Project Drueth. The renewal with Casionix Partners closes at $142.5 million a year, 8.3 percent below the last contract. Project Fraax slips by six weeks because of the tooling delay.

Before we ship GrowMate 4.2, double-check the sensor drift fix for the humidity probes. Last cycle the Fernvale greenhouse pilot saw readings creep up about 2% per week, and the new recalibration loop is supposed to zero that out every six hours. Please confirm the soak test ran a full 72 hours on the staging rack, not the abbreviated 12-hour pass we used for 4.1. It's a quick sign-off but don't skip it. Verify the soak test was run against the build stamped below.

build token for bahip-fawif: htk3_6a1

Internal Memo — Budget Request

To the sales leads: Operations has submitted a budget request to fund two additional demo kits for the Vellane product line and travel support for the Ashgrove territory push. Finance expects a decision within two weeks. No changes to current spending limits until then; log any urgent needs with your regional coordinator. Background on the request's purpose appears below.

board note of fahaf-fadug: Gilixax Logistics is in early talks to buy Praiusax Partners for about $8.1 million. The Pramir launch date is September 23, and nothing goes to the press before then.